The Benefits of Solar Power in West Vancouver's Coastal Environment
Regardless of regular marine clouds, West Vancouver averages 1,100-1,200 kWh/m² of solar energy per year-sufficient for modern high‑efficiency panels to generate excellent returns. You benefit from abundant summer light, cool ambient temperatures that improve output, and net metering to profit from surplus generation. Data from equivalent coastal regions indicates limited winter drop-off when systems are designed for rainy season efficiency, employing high‑yield modules and smart inverters to collect diffuse light.
You'll significantly reduce corrosion issues with equipment rated for coastal salt tolerance: salt‑mist-certified panels, sealed connectors, marine‑grade fasteners, and anodized aluminum frames (IEC 61701). Combine that with half‑cut cells, low‑loss cabling, and precisely adjusted tilt angles tuned for shoulder seasons. The result: consistent kWh, lower utility costs, decreased carbon output, and a durable asset tailored for West Vancouver's climate.

Professional Solar Hardware and Installation Materials
We select components that maximize efficiency: we implement Tier-1, high‑efficiency modules (incorporating n‑type TOPCon/HJT, 21-23% efficiency) with 25-30‑year performance warranties, paired with inverters optimized for your site-string with fast shutdown protection and 97-99% CEC efficiency, or microinverters for difficult roof configurations and shading reduction.
You receive quantifiable benefits: increased kWh/㎡, reduced LCOE, and better uptime. In locations with suitable ground or flat roofs, bifacial modules boost rear‑side gains 5-15% with reflective surfaces. In cases of irregular installations, integrated microinverters maximizes per‑module harvest, simplifies expansion, and delivers granular monitoring. Prefer a central layout? High-performance string inverters with AFCI and arc‑fault logging maintain peak efficiency.
Mounting is crucial in West Vancouver's marine environment. We use corrosion‑resistant aluminum and stainless components, all tested to CSA/UL, with engineered rails, flashing, and environmental load capacities that suit your location.
Safety Standards and Installation Process
While every roof and service panel is unique, your installation follows a systematic, code‑compliant procedure: we carry out a property evaluation with shading and structural measurements, design the configuration, and file permits with the District of West Vancouver. You'll notice distinct phases: roof preparation, framework and cabling, panel installation, and BC Safety Authority sign‑off. We utilize certified engineering designs, fall protection equipment, and sealed penetrations tested to CSA and NEC/CEC standards.
Our certified technicians configure and install dedicated circuits, properly label conductors, apply specified torque requirements, and pass all municipal and utility electrical inspections. We manage meter replacements and anti‑islanding checks, followed by delivering as‑built drawings and detailed commissioning reports. Standard residential projects are completed in 1-3 days once permitting is complete. At every stage, we prioritize worker safety, securing your property, and certified code compliance.
